Subject: [PATCH v2 2/9] ARM: Kirkwood: Remove platform driver for codec
Date: Sat,  3 May 2014 20:30:12 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1399141819-23924-3-git-send-email-andrew@lunn.ch>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1399141819-23924-1-git-send-email-andrew@lunn.ch>

Remove the platform driver and platform data for the audio codec.
A DT node will replace it.

Signed-off-by: Andrew Lunn <andrew@lunn.ch>
---
 arch/arm/mach-mvebu/board-t5325.c | 15 ---------------
 1 file changed, 15 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/board-t5325.c b/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/board-t5325.c
index 65ace6db9f28..f2401b298218 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/board-t5325.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/board-t5325.c
@@ -11,10 +11,8 @@
  */
 
 #include <linux/kernel.h>
-#include <linux/i2c.h>
 #include <linux/init.h>
 #include <linux/platform_device.h>
-#include <sound/alc5623.h>
 #include "board.h"
 
 static struct platform_device hp_t5325_audio_device = {
@@ -22,20 +20,7 @@ static struct platform_device hp_t5325_audio_device = {
 	.id		= -1,
 };
 
-static struct alc5623_platform_data alc5621_data = {
-	.add_ctrl = 0x3700,
-	.jack_det_ctrl = 0x4810,
-};
-
-static struct i2c_board_info i2c_board_info[] __initdata = {
-	{
-		I2C_BOARD_INFO("alc5621", 0x1a),
-		.platform_data = &alc5621_data,
-	},
-};
-
 void __init t5325_init(void)
 {
-	i2c_register_board_info(0, i2c_board_info, ARRAY_SIZE(i2c_board_info));
 	platform_device_register(&hp_t5325_audio_device);
 }
